The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ario (AGCO) is an agency where innovation thrives, ideas flourish, and passion drives us to new heights of excellence. Reporting to the Ministry of the Attorney General, the AGCO is responsible for regulating Ontario’s vibrant alcohol, gaming, horse racing, and private retail cannabis sectors in accordance with the principles of honesty and integrity, and in the public interest.
The Legal Services Division at the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ario (AGCO) provides essential legal services that support the organization’s regulatory role. The team plays a critical role in supporting and advising on regulatory responses and sector governance, advising on a wide range of corporate and administrative law issues, representing the Registrar at Tribunal and Court proceedings, preparing legal documentation for regulatory decisions, advising in relation to ongoing compliance matters, drafting contracts, impacting legislative developments, and providing legal support for regulatory governance and policy initiatives.
We are looking for a Senior Law Clerk to join our team.
Under the direction of the Legal Director, you will have the opportunity to make a meaningful impact in the following ways:
Leveraging your superior written communication and organizational skills, prepare legal documentation, and provide legal support services.
Provide both administrative and clerical support services to Counsel.
Provide detailed and technical information internally and to the public and licensees/registrants, including as related to status of matters.
Review files at each stage of the various compliance and eligibility processes to ensure that they are complete and accurate in accordance with the Division Manual and request additional materials as required.
Prepare documentation for hearings, appeals and judicial review applications consistent with applicable rules of practice or procedure.
Apply legislation to extract information from reports and applications and draft the initial copy of relevant documentation.
Maintain files in an orderly manner consistent with Division practices.
Monitor the status of files and prepare monthly statistics and a monthly report tracking the files, including numbers and status.
Proactively identify and alert counsel to issues and potential risks, including as related to timelines, service and communications.
You Have:
A minimum of 3 years’ experience as a Law Clerk, preferably in a regulatory environment.
Completion of a post-secondary Law Clerk program, or ILCO Certification.
Superior writing skills including the ability to compile information from files in order to draft documentation.
Research abilities required to find relevant cases and supporting records.
The ability to work within strict time constraints while maintaining a high volume of work.
The ability to meet constant deadlines by working both independently as well as collaboratively in a highly engaged team environment.
Detail orientation with strong organizational and prioritization skills.
A working knowledge of legal terminology and phraseology in order to prepare legal documents
Familiarity with the application of various pieces of legislation (i.e. Liquor Licence and Control Act, Gaming Control Act, Horse Racing Licence Act, Cannabis Licence Act, Highway Traffic Act and Criminal Code).
Strong interpersonal and verbal communication skills with an ability to liaise with internal and external stakeholders (i.e. AGCO staff, police, court office employees and the public).
Advanced computer skills using various MS Office Suite Programs, and experience using Quick Law, West Law and Canlii.
